The Ibanez PowerPad Designer IBB541 is a lightweight, durable electric bass gig bag crafted from premium polyester canvas. Weighing just 2.9 pounds, it features comfortable shoulder straps and a sturdy web handle for easy transport, plus a secure zipper closure to protect your instrument. Its sleek black design offers a professional, minimalist look perfect for the modern musician on the move.

Weird fit even with Ibanez bass!
The price is decent for what u get. Nice pockets and slots. Easy to carry. I got this for an Ibanez bass however, and it has trouble zipping over the headstock. I have to kind of force it and it's very tight. Odd. Most times it forces the bass out of tune because of the weird fit.Other than that, it’s fine enough for the price.

Great case for the money
Great case for the money! It is padded enough to get to and from my practice session. I wouldn't use it for a plane or touring obviously but it gets the job done to put around town. Fits my 35' Scale and 37" multi scale just fine. The multiscale is a tight fit but i was surprised it fit in there Pockets are good for 1 speaker and 2 instrument cables, and 2-3 pedals depending depending on if you have external power sources for them. And the little zipper up top is good for picks and ear protection. Basically fits anything you might need
